Output 6435ac1ec00bbe6d05944df1de0eb7e0b4c84f703a20b9bf38c3ad4ff13c21b3:21

value
2510782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 713b64481c67bef66be9fd8711c686e1af9a41f1 OP_EQUAL
address
3C1jRq6QoTM8rxN6iL9pjy1UcH7yoBE9sh
transaction
6435ac1ec00bbe6d05944df1de0eb7e0b4c84f703a20b9bf38c3ad4ff13c21b3
spent
true